Briefing — Leadership Review: Reseller Programme

Prepared for the finance team. The Varnette reseller programme added 42 partners this year; tier-two partners now drive 28% of channel revenue. Rebate accruals are tracking above forecast and require a reserve adjustment. Onboarding costs fell after the Kestrel portal launch. Please model margin impact for both tiers. The confidential expansion plan appears directly below.

internal memo for kawip-hadug: Headcount on the Wenwyn team goes from 7 to 140 by the end of January. Gross margin on Wenwyn came in at 20 percent against a plan of 15 percent.

Document Transport — Seed Samples (Trial Plot Runs)

When the Ridgemoor agronomy unit requests seed samples for the Eastfen trial plot, the office manager books a same-day courier through Larkbridge Couriers. Samples ship in the sealed blue caddy with the chain-of-custody card tucked in the lid pocket. Keep the caddy out of direct sun while awaiting pick-up. Record departure time in the transport log. The courier completes the hand-over per the instruction below.

handover note for yagef-bagep: the drudor pelius courier leaves the kasdor zorvan norir ledger at gate 8016 under passcode 755406

The Eventspool Schema Registry exposes a read-only HTTP interface that plugin authors use to fetch event schemas at build time. All requests must include an authentication header; unauthenticated calls are rejected with a 401. Schemas are versioned, and plugins should pin to a specific version rather than tracking latest. During development against the staging registry, authenticate with the shared internal key provided below.

gateway credential: kto3_qfe

Subject: DR drill recap — ValidatorForge plugins

Hey team,

Quick note from Thursday's disaster-recovery drill: the ValidatorForge plugin registry restored cleanly on the Quillhaven standby, though plugin sandboxing took two retries. Dasha is writing up the timing gaps before the weekly sync. To complete the drill paperwork, we had to regenerate the registry's recovery credentials, so noting the passphrase here for the record.

vault phrase of kawep-tahog = ulaix-briath